2. APERÇU DU PRODUIT

Le [Nom du fabricant] Automated Brick Making Machine is a stationary blockmaking system designed for highvolume, production constante de solides, creux, paver, et briques emboîtables. Il intègre le traitement des matériaux, precise compaction, and automated handling into a continuous workflow.

Flux de travail opérationnel:
1. Alimentation & Mélange: Matière première préparée (par ex., cementaggregate mix, solciment) is conveyed into the machine’s integrated mixer for homogenous blending.
2. Moulage de précision: The mixture is fed into a rigid mold box. A combination of hydraulic pressure and highfrequency vibration ensures thorough compaction and sharp brick definition.
3. Éjection automatisée & Palettisation: The freshly molded brick block is ejected onto a pallet or conveyor belt without manual intervention, maintaining structural integrity.
4. Guérison & Manutention: Pallets are transferred to a curing rack or area. Systems can be integrated with automatic stackers/unstackers for streamlined yard management.

Champ d'application: Ideal for established brick yards, construction companies with inhouse production needs, and entrepreneurs entering the building materials sector. Suitable for producing ASTM/CIS standard bricks.

Limites: Requires a prepared raw material feed of consistent granulometry; not designed for primary crushing of large aggregate. Stationary design necessitates a dedicated production floor space with appropriate foundation.

5. SPÉCIFICATIONS TECHNIQUES

Désignation du modèle: BMMAH12
Capacité de production: Jusqu'à 1,500 standard solid blocks per hour (theoretical maxdependent on block type).
Exigences d'alimentation: Main Drive – 45 kW; Vibrator Motors – 2 x 7。5 kW; Hydraulic System – 22 kW。 Total Connected Load~82 kW。 Tension:380V/50Hz/3Phase。
Spécifications matérielles: Compatible avec les cendres volantes, ciment, sable, agrégat (≤10mm),pierre concassée。 Teneur en humidité optimale:812%。
Dimensions physiques (Machine Only): L6。5m x W3。2mxH3。8m。 Poids approximatif:14,500 kilos。
Plage de fonctionnement environnementale: Designed for indoor installation or under shelter。 Plage de température ambiante:5°C à 40°C。 Humidité: ≤80% noncondensing
